let’s give a warm welcome for our latest addition to the harlem station family, Denvil Saine. We found this guy in our own backyard and his talent is limitless. we have just signed a song from him, a glorious deep house number called “let go”. you will be hearing it and the remixes soon. he is currently working on a full length album and so far the organic element is working severely. here is some more about him.

Singer/Writer ….Born in Texas, and raised in Houston and San Antonio, my love of music was sealed after hearingThe Crusaders’ “Street Life”. I can’t recall the exact moment I heard this song as a child, but I remember immediately feeling a deep connection to it. I made my dad play this album all the time and never got sick of hearing it. I began singing around age eleven when a choir director asked me to sing a solo in church. I definitley attribute this experience with giving me the confidence and interest to continue singing. While pursuing my Bachelor’s degree in liberal arts at Carleton College, I continued to write and sing in a small jazz band. It was definitely through writing songs that I found a way to cope with my own experiences, and soon realized that this was a way to translate these experiences into something tangible.
